The chassis used in this radio is fundamentally similar to those of many of the
other 1940 types, and even carried over to postwar production. It incorporated several innovations and presented
a leap forward in performance for post-1939 radios.
See also type Mullard MAS95. A postwar version of this radio is
type Philips 256A. A battery powered type 635V was also produced.
